Man injured in knife attack in Grefrath
A 20-year-old man was injured by a knife stab in a car park near a festival tent in Grefrath during the night into Friday. According to the investigation so far, he had first been involved in a verbal dispute with three men. One of the men is alleged to have drawn a knife and injured him.
Emergency responders took the man to hospital for inpatient treatment. His life was initially considered potentially at risk, but his condition later stabilised and he remained under medical care. Police arrested a minor suspect, while another person involved turned himself in at a police station. The other two people initially detained were released because there was no urgent suspicion against them. A homicide investigation unit is investigating suspected attempted homicide.
